CellSPU:
(a) Slight rethink on i64 zero/sign/any extend code - use a shuffle to directly zero-extend i32 to i64, but use rotates and shifts for sign extension. Also ensure unified register consistency. (b) Add new test harness for i64 operations: i64ops.ll git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@59970 91177308-0d34-0410-b5e6-96231b3b80d8
